Can You Freeze Homemade Vodka Sauce. Yes, homemade vodka sauce can be frozen. Once you are ready to use your frozen vodka sauce, just follow the. Let the sauce c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container or freezer bag. When you’re ready to use your frozen vodka sauce, simply heat it up in the microwave or on the stovetop. Leave some space for expansion. Freezing vodka sauce for later use is an amazing idea to ensure you always have fresh vodka sauce on hand. It’s also a good idea to thaw the sauce in the fridge before reheating to make sure it heats evenly. This allows you to make large batches of homemade sauce. Vodka sauce can be frozen in an airtight container for up to six months. Freezing vodka sauce is a great way to extend its shelf life and have it on hand for later use.
